  1. By William Maley Staff Writer - CheersandGears.com March 13, 2013 Volkswagen has chosen New York as the place to show the North American version of the Mark 7 Golf. Coming as 2015 model, the Mark 7 Golf will be shown in three different variations; the base 1.8L TSI engine, the TDI, and the hot GTI. Volkswagen says the new Golf arrives in North America in the first half of 2014. Source: Volkswagen William Maley is a staff writer for Cheers & Gears. Press Release is on Page 2 2015 Volkswagen Golf to Make its US Debut in New York NYIAS Press Days: March 27 & 28 Three Golf versions will debut in New York The 2015 Volkswagen Golf is bigger inside and out, lighter, more fuel efficient, and safer than the vehicle it replaces. The seventh-generation Golf is the first Volkswagen to use the new MQB components matrix and will offer new safety features-such as collision avoidance and lane departure systems-as well as new engines and infotainment options. At the New York International Auto Show, Volkswagen is debuting all three of the Golf versions that will go on sale next year: the entry-level TSI model; the thrifty TDI Clean Diesel; and the sporty GTI. The TSI and GTI use new versions of the EA888 turbocharged and direct-injected four-cylinder engine, while the TDI gets the new EA288 diesel engine. The 2015 Golf will go on sale in the first half of 2014 and will be built at Volkswagen's Puebla, Mexico, factory.
